We are proud to introduce first free professional Magento theme. Feel free to download it from our Magento templates store or Magento Connect. Check theme demo of our free magento theme at our demo server.
- CSS3 Powered!
- Easy color changes
- Easy to upgrade, easy to customise
- Supports all main browsers (IE6,IE7,IE8,FF2,FF3,Opera,Safari)
- Free updates included
Magento classic theme is available in 10 colors now. Additional colors can be also downloaded at our server.
Installation instruction and source .psd file is included in this package.
Template is available under Creative Commons License for commercial and personal use.
